>>   Folks, I have an interesting question: Why does one work and the other
>> does NOT? The only difference (I know of) between the two systems is
>> ursa was an upgrade from 10.04.4LTS to 12.04.1LTS and kodiak is a fresh
>> install. Both are up to date. Is kodiak missing a software package, if
>> so which one? WORKS --> cdjsys at ursa:/$ cat /etc/fstab |grep nfs
>> #polar:/archive /archive nfs rw,noauto 0 0 koala:/nfs/cdjsys
>> /big_archive nfs rw,noauto,nolock 0 0 cdjsys at ursa:/$ sudo mount
>> /big_archive [sudo] password for cdjsys: cdjsys at ursa:/$ df |grep koala
>> koala:/nfs/cdjsys 973391744 13308704 960083040 2% /big_archive
>> cdjsys at ursa:/$ uname -a Linux ursa 3.2.0-30-generic #48-Ubuntu SMP Fri
>> Aug 24 16:54:40 UTC 2012 i686 i686 i386 GNU/Linux cdjsys at ursa:/$ and
>> FAILS --> cdjsys at kodiak:~$ cat /etc/fstab |grep nfs # entry for
>> nfs:cdjsys on koala koala:/nfs/cdjsys /big_archive nfs rw,noauto,nolock
>> 0 0 cdjsys at kodiak:~$ sudo mount /big_archive [sudo] password for
>> cdjsys: mount.nfs: requested NFS version or transport protocol is not
>> supported cdjsys at kodiak:~$ uname -a Linux kodiak 3.2.0-30-generic-pae
>> #48-Ubuntu SMP Fri Aug 24 17:14:09 UTC 2012 i686 i686 i386 GNU/Linux
>> cdjsys at kodiak:~$  You might try adding vers=3 to your mount options. I
>> have seen this before with the newer NFS releases. Clint
